When the Toronto Blue Jays selected Travis Snider in 2007, it marked a significant change in the drafting philosophy held by current General Manager J.P. Riccardi.   In previous drafts Riccardi would focus on safe college players with less upside whose path to the majors would be relatively short, but with Snider Riccardi opted with not only the best high cchool bat in the draft but also a player who represents an extremely high ceiling.  Contact Skills: 8.2/10 Snider is a rare breed of power prospect who has the type of swing capable of hitting over .300 through his career.   Though Snider packs a lot of power in his swing, he has very quick hands able to turn on any pitch.  Most sluggers like Snider generally like to pull the ball, but Snider likes to spray the ball around while some of his most powerful bombs have gone opposite field.   In both Rookie and A Ball Snider hit for a combined .319 on his way to winning MVP in the Appalachian League.
